Recording the details of the accident

Whether you're filing a personal injury lawsuit or attempting to make a case for an insurance company, you need to record the details of the auto accident compensation accident. Failure to do this could result in the loss of valuable evidence. The evidence of the incident can help investigators determine if you're accountable for the injuries and property damage you caused.

The first thing you must do after an accident is call 9-1-1 to report the collision. The police will then take care of clearing the scene. They will ask you to provide your contact details and exchange insurance information with the driver who was at fault.

The next step is to take photos of the scene. Photos can prove critical information about the incident. Photographs of the accident scene, including the car and other vehicles and the traffic at the time should be taken. You should also capture any skid marks or other evidence of the accident.

In addition to photos, you should document any injuries or property damage you've suffered. If you're hurt you're hurt, seek medical attention immediately. It is a good idea for witnesses to give statements to the police.

A copy of the official police reports needs to be requested. You can request one online or pay a small fee at your local police station.

All medical bills and bills should be kept after an accident. Keep track of all repair and towing costs. Also keep track of any details about your life and auto Accident lawsuit that of the driver who is driving you. This will help you in court.

You can also make a video recording of the accident. A video will give you amazing images of the incident as well as any other lights or other objects. You can also capture weather and traffic conditions at the time of an accident.

It is also essential to document the damages to the vehicles. Photograph any personal items in the vehicle, and also damage to the exterior of the car. The photos of the damage can help the experts determine how the car was affected.

Seeking medical attention after the accident

Getting medical attention after the accident is important, regardless of whether it's an accident that is minor in nature or a major one. A crash can be stressful and emotionally traumatic and it is crucial to get help when you need it. It is crucial to recognize that injuries may not be apparent immediately following an accident, and that you may not be aware of your injuries.

Some of the signs of a car accident might not appear for several days or even weeks. Because of the shock caused by the crash your body may release adrenaline which can mask the pain temporarily. It is possible that you don't realize you have an injury until later, if you don't seek medical attention.

It is important to visit your doctor as soon as you experience any pain or aches. You should also record any injuries or damage to your vehicle. In the event that you decide to make a claim, you will need a detailed medical report on your condition. If you don't have insurance then your health is the primary concern therefore, make sure you seek treatment as soon as possible.

You must also think about your mental health. You might be embarrassed, ashamed or overwhelmed after a car accident. If you don't get the assistance you require and require, you could have difficulty making decisions.

It is best to keep a list every day of any aches or pains you experience after an accident. If you decide to make an insurance claim it will help you feel better and help strengthen your case.

It is crucial to follow all directions given by your doctor. This includes taking prescribed medication, resting, and participating in physical therapy. This will help you heal and recover faster. The insurance company might argue that your injuries might not be as serious if you don't adhere to doctor's instructions.

Be sure to keep all follow-up appointments with your doctor. This will help you get better and stronger in your case.

In dealing with insurance companies following the accident

It is essential to contact your insurance provider when you're involved in an accident. If the driver of another vehicle is responsible it is important to report the incident to their insurance company.

It is recommended to consult an attorney prior to talking to the at-fault driver’s insurance company. They will know what to say and what not to say. This will help you stay on the right track in the claim process.

Before you talk to an insurance adjuster, it is important to document the accident scene. Photograph the scene of the accident and any injuries. It is important to obtain the contact information of witnesses. It is also a good idea to create a post-accident journal. You can use this to create a record for court.

An adjuster from insurance will try to minimize the amount you are owed. This is because they are working for the financial interest of the insurance company.

If you've been injured, it is essential to seek medical treatment. It is also essential to have your expenses in order. You should keep your medical bills separated from your car repair bills. This will ensure you get an appropriate amount.

You should be ready to negotiate a settlement with your insurer. The process of dealing with an insurance company following an accident can be stressful. They will try to limit the amount they are willing to pay, and they may suggest fraud. In addition, they may threaten you with losing your license, or even suspending your vehicle. If you're dissatisfied with the initial offer, you can consider negotiating a higher settlement.

You shouldn't just keep the track of your expenses, but also keep track of your injuries. Also, you should record the details of the incident including the names of any witnesses. You should also take photographs of the damage to the vehicle. You can send these photos to your insurer as well.

In the end, you must avoid a conflict with an insurance company. If you're speaking to an at-fault driver's insurer or your own, you should always be honest and friendly.
